AN ACT1
To amend and reenact R.S. 34:3494(A), (B)(3), and (D), to enact R.S. 34:3499(A)(10), and2
to repeal R.S. 34:3494(B)(9), relative to the Louisiana International Gulf Transfer3
and Terminal Authority; to provide for changes in the board membership; to provide4
for powers of the authority; to provide for the payment of certain expenses; and to5
provide for related matters.6
Be it enacted by the Legislature of Louisiana:7
Section 1. R.S. 34:3494(A), (B)(3), and (D) are hereby amended and reenacted and8
R.S. 34:3499(A)(10) is hereby enacted to read as follows: 9
§3494. Board of commissioners; qualifications; term; vacancies; compensation10
A. The authority shall be governed by a board of 	sixteen fifteen11
commissioners, consisting of the secretary of the Department of Economic12
Development and the secretary of the Department of Transportation and13
Development, the chairmen of the House and Senate committees on transportation,14
highways, and public works or their designees and twelve eleven commissioners15
appointed by the governor to be chosen on the basis of their demonstrated experience16
in maritime or business leadership, or both, and their stature and ability to act17
effectively for the best interests of Louisiana. Such commissioners shall not be18
appointed or elected commissioners or board members of any other Louisiana port.19
B. Commissioners shall be chosen as follows:20
*          *          *21
(3) One member shall be selected from a list of three nominees submitted by22
the New Orleans Steamship Louisiana Maritime Association.23
*          *          *24
D. The members of the board of commissioners shall serve without25
compensation but shall be reimbursed for travel expenses incurred in attending26
meetings or performing duties authorized by the board of commissioners at rates27

and standards as promulgated by the division of administration.1
*          *          *2
§3499. Powers3
A. The authority shall be empowered to do any and all things necessary or4
proper to carry out the purposes of this Chapter, including but not limited to the5
following:6
*          *          *7
(10) To accept and use any gift, grant, donation, or otherwise any sum8
of money, or property, aid or assistance from the United States, the state of9
Louisiana, or any political subdivision thereof, or any person or legal entity for10
purposes consistent with responsibilities and functions of the authority.11
*          *          *12
Section 2.  R.S. 34:3494(B)(9) is hereby repealed.13
Section 3. The terms of the members serving on the effective date of this Act as14
commissioners who were selected from the lists submitted by the Mississippi River15
Maritime Association and the New Orleans Steamship Association shall terminate as of the16
effective date of this Act.17
Section 4. This Act shall become effective upon signature by the governor or, if not18
signed by the governor, upon expiration of the time for bills to become law without signature19
by the governor, as provided by Article III, Section 18 of the Constitution of Louisiana. If20
vetoed by the governor and subsequently approved by the legislature, this Act shall become21
effective on the day following such approval.22
